Picture this: your marketing team at a mid-sized bank, focused on business lending, is tasked with creating a fresh, immersive brand experience aimed at attracting younger commercial borrowers. The buzz around the metaverse is loud, the vendors are many, and the pressure from leadership to innovate is high. Your role as a team lead isn’t to build the experience yourself, but to steer the evaluation and selection of the right vendor. How do you cut through the noise? How do you set criteria that align with your bank’s business goals, regulatory constraints, and operational realities — including costs tied to energy consumption?

The strategic evaluation of metaverse vendors is uncharted territory for many banks, especially in lending, where trust and compliance weigh heavy. This article frames a practical approach focused on metaverse vendor evaluation for manager-level marketing teams, spotlighting how energy costs in operations can quietly tip the balance in vendor selection—and how to run a process that your team can follow and iterate. Drawing on frameworks like Gartner’s Vendor Evaluation Model (2023) and first-hand insights from banking marketing leads, we also highlight caveats such as evolving regulatory landscapes and technology maturity.

What’s Driving the Interest in Metaverse Vendor Evaluation — and Why It’s Messy

Imagine the promise: a virtual lobby where small business owners can interact with loan officers, AI-driven financial advisors guide application processes, and networking lounges foster community among borrowers. This futuristic vision excites marketing leaders who see it as a way to differentiate brand experience beyond traditional channels.

Yet, reality hits hard. For many banks, the metaverse ecosystem feels like the Wild West — vendors with different technology stacks, inconsistent compliance readiness, and wildly varying cost structures. According to a 2024 Forrester report, 62% of financial services firms experimenting with metaverse brand initiatives reported unclear ROI in the first 18 months, often due to underestimated operational expenses.

Energy consumption is a subtle but crucial factor. Some virtual environments demand intense server usage and client-side rendering, pushing up electricity bills and cooling system loads. For a business lender managing operational budgets tightly, an oversight here can mean exceeding cost forecasts by tens of thousands annually—a risk rarely highlighted upfront by vendors. From my experience leading vendor evaluations at a regional bank in 2023, energy cost surprises were a key reason for delayed project approvals.

Structuring Your Metaverse Vendor Evaluation Framework

Delegating the vendor evaluation process to your team means giving them a framework that balances innovation ambition with practical rigor. Start by breaking down the evaluation into three pillars, inspired by the Balanced Scorecard approach adapted for technology vendor selection:

Pillar Key Focus Areas Example Metrics/Questions
Experience Alignment Brand storytelling, platform flexibility CRM integration, multi-device support, UX customization
Operational Feasibility Infrastructure demands, energy consumption, compliance Energy cost estimates, audit readiness, staffing needs
Performance Validation Pilot testing, outcome measurement Engagement rates, conversion lifts, borrower feedback

Pillar 1: Experience Alignment in Metaverse Vendor Evaluation

The storytelling aspect is paramount. Picture a small business owner in a 3D virtual office, guided through a loan pre-qualification test by a reliable AI avatar. Can the vendor’s platform support multi-channel engagement, accessible on desktops and mobile VR headsets? Does it have the flexibility to integrate your existing CRM and loan origination system?

One bank’s marketing team ran into trouble when they chose a vendor whose metaverse experience focused heavily on gamified onboarding but could not feed data back into their core systems, creating a disconnect between marketing and loan processing teams.

Implementation Steps for Experience Alignment:

  • Map your borrower personas and their preferred devices (desktop, mobile, VR)
  • Request vendor demos highlighting CRM and loan system integrations
  • Use user journey mapping workshops with stakeholders to validate storytelling fit
  • Include customization flexibility as a scoring criterion in your RFP

Pillar 2: Operational Feasibility — Including Energy Costs in Metaverse Vendor Evaluation

Imagine two vendors: Vendor A offers a photorealistic environment requiring high GPU rendering, live streaming, and extensive real-time data processing. Vendor B opts for a stylized, less resource-intensive platform coded to minimize server load. Both promise similar user engagement, but the energy cost difference is stark.

Energy consumption isn’t just an environmental talking point; it’s an operational budget line. According to a 2023 internal study by a regional bank, selecting Vendor A resulted in a 35% increase in their IT facilities’ electricity usage, adding $18,000 annually. Vendor B’s platform, by contrast, added under $5,000.

Operational feasibility also covers:

  • Compliance with banking data security standards (e.g., GDPR, CCPA, PCI DSS)
  • Vendor readiness for audits and regulatory scrutiny
  • Scalability in line with loan marketing campaigns
  • Staffing requirements for content updates and experience monitoring

Pillar 3: Performance Validation via RFPs and POCs in Metaverse Vendor Evaluation

Your team will need to create an RFP that drills down into the metaverse experience with quantifiable objectives. Don’t just ask for demos; demand Proof of Concept (POC) pilots. For example, run a three-week test with a small segment of your borrower base invited to prototype environments.

Metrics to collect:

  • Engagement rates (session time, interaction types)
  • Conversion lifts (loan application starts and completions)
  • Qualitative borrower feedback (via tools like Zigpoll and Medallia)
  • Energy monitoring data from IT teams during POC runs

One marketing lead shared how their pilot went from a 2% loan inquiry rate in the traditional digital channel to 11% in the metaverse test group, but they only realized this after cross-checking energy consumption projections—ensuring the scale-up made financial sense.

Delegating and Managing the Metaverse Vendor Evaluation Process

As a team lead, your job is to orchestrate, not micromanage. Delegate the technical energy cost assessment to your IT liaison and the compliance review to legal. Your marketing analysts can focus on user experience feedback and performance data.

Set clear milestones:

  • RFP issuance with energy cost and compliance questions by Week 1
  • Vendor demos and preliminary scoring by Week 3
  • POC planning and execution by Week 6
  • Final evaluation and recommendations by Week 10

Create shared documentation (like a scoring spreadsheet) visible to all stakeholders. This transparency helps teams understand trade-offs—like when a vendor’s immersive environment boosts engagement but outweighs operational budgets.

Comparison Table: Roles and Responsibilities in Vendor Evaluation

Role Responsibilities Example Deliverables
Marketing Lead Overall coordination, criteria setting Evaluation framework, final recommendation
IT Liaison Energy cost analysis, infrastructure review Energy usage reports, technical feasibility
Legal/Compliance Regulatory review, contract terms Compliance checklist, audit readiness report
Marketing Analysts User feedback collection, data analysis Engagement metrics, Zigpoll survey summaries

Measurement Beyond Launch in Metaverse Vendor Evaluation

Once a vendor is selected and the metaverse experience launches, the story isn’t over. Measurement should continue with quarterly reviews incorporating borrower behavior tracking, energy consumption reports, and feedback surveys (Zigpoll remains a strong choice for quick, mobile-friendly borrower inputs).

Be aware of limitations. Metaverse experiences might not suit all business borrower segments—older business owners may prefer traditional digital channels. Also, regulatory changes can suddenly impact data collection practices in these virtual spaces. According to a 2024 Deloitte study, 28% of banks paused metaverse initiatives due to emerging data privacy regulations.

Scaling with Sensible Growth in Metaverse Vendor Evaluation

Scaling means involving other banking lines beyond business lending, like wealth management or retail loans, but only after ironing out operational kinks and proving ROI. Take your energy cost learnings and push vendors to optimize platform efficiency. Vendors who invest in green cloud services or edge computing often reduce energy footprints and improve latency, winning extra points in your evaluations.

Mini Definition: Edge Computing
A distributed computing framework that brings computation and data storage closer to the location where it is needed to improve response times and save bandwidth.
